India's Trade Ambitions: New Deals Aim for $112B

Story summary
  • The India-United Kingdom Comprehensive Economic and Trade Agreement (CETA) is set for early 2026, aiming to double bilateral trade to $112 billion and secure duty-free access for 99% of Indian exports.
  • India finalized a Free Trade Agreement with New Zealand to boost market access while safeguarding agriculture.
  • India continues negotiations with the United States over tariffs, while the rupee declines amid these trade developments.
